[CNA] Climate crisis and Cyprus at the meeting between Anastasiades and Kerry in France

The climate crisis and developments in the Cyprus problem were the focus of a meeting today between President Nicos Anastasiades and President Biden's Special Envoy for Climate Change and former US Secretary of State John Kerry, shortly before the start of the "One Ocean" Summit to be held on Friday in Brest, France.

According to a written statement by Government Spokesman, Marios Pelekanos, the meeting discussed the challenges faced by all of humanity as a result of the climate crisis, as well as the contribution of Cyprus and the United States, respectively, to the green transition and greenhouse gas emission reduction process.
